I set traps in what I walk out of the house in, that varies with the weather obviously. Anything that's on my shoes, coats, or pants the coyotes have smelled already. I'm not saying you should go roll around in 90 weight gear oil and go set by any means, but there's no need for a full latex suit either. Like stated above by many, get in get out and bravery varies from coyote to coyote.

Kind of a long article but I found it interesting. It references wolves' abilities to detect odor that would probably be similar to coyotes. I think canines (and deer) can age human scent and react accordingly. I've watched both red fox and coyotes hit my trail a few minutes after I passed on my way into deer stands turn inside out but several hours later hit that same trail with a quick sniff but no real reaction.https://www.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/pmc/articles/PMC4859551/ |  |  |
